Ingredients: 7-1/2 cups water 12 tbsp (1-1/2 sticks) unsalted butter 2 tsp garlic salt 2 tsp onion salt 2 (8 oz) pkgs cream cheese, cubed and softened 1 (12 oz) can evaporated milk 1 (16 oz) container sour cream 1 (15.3 oz) pkg Hungry Jack instant mashed potatoes (9 cups) paprika cooked bacon, chopped (optional, unless you love bacon) fresh parsley, chopped (optional)
|
|
Directions: |
Directions:Preheat oven to 350º. Spray a 9x13-inch baking dish with no-stick cooking spray. Heat water, butter, garlic salt and onion salt to boiling in a 6-quart Dutch oven or saucepan. Remove from heat. Add cream cheese, evaporated milk and sour cream; stirring until cream cheese is dissolved. Stir in potato flakes; mixing until all ingredients are well combined. Spread mashed potato mixture into prepared pan. Sprinkle with paprika and bake for 1 hour. Top with chopped bacon and parsley, if desired. Makes 20 servings. |
